
Using SMTP Auth with Eudora for Mac.
- Open Eudora
- From the Special menu choose Settings, which brings up
the settings window.
- Click on Getting Started and enter the following from your
Account Information:
Login Name: your Email Account/POP Username from your Account
Information
Mail Server: mail.chpl.net or zeus.chapel1.com.
This will be the part of your address after your e-mail
(Example Lee@zeus.chapel1.com
would have a mail server of zeus.chapel1.com)
Real name: your name the way you want it to appear on messages from you
SMTP Server: lee@zeus.chapel1.com
Return address: your E-mail Alias or E-mail/Reply-To Address from
your Account Information

- Then, click on Sending Mail
and make sure you have the following:
SMTP Server: zeus.chapel1.com or mail.chpl.net
Check Allow Authorization

Click OK
- You're Done! You have set up your Eudora Email program to check
your Chapel email.
Unfortunately, Eudora doesn't have separate username and password settings
for the Incoming and Outgoing mail servers. So, you can only use
mail.chpl.net or zeus.chapel1.com with an email personality (set of settings)
that will check your pop3 mail as well.
This is a limitation of Eudora's software.
